How to fill out patient disclosure form

How to fill out patient disclosure form
01
Read the instructions: Start by carefully reading the instructions provided with the patient disclosure form.
02
Provide personal information: Fill in your full name, date of birth, address, and contact information in the designated fields.
03
State your medical history: Provide details about your previous medical conditions, allergies, surgeries, medications, and any known hereditary conditions.
04
List current symptoms: Describe any current symptoms or complaints you are experiencing in detail.
05
Include current medications: Mention the names and dosages of any prescription or over-the-counter medications you are currently taking.
06
Disclose mental health history: If applicable, provide information regarding any mental health conditions or treatments received.
07
Sign and date the form: Once you have filled out all the necessary information, sign and date the patient disclosure form.
08
Review the form: Before submitting the form, review all the information you have provided to ensure its accuracy and completeness.
09
Submit the form: Follow the instructions provided on how to submit the form, whether it's through mail, email, or in-person at a healthcare facility.
Who needs patient disclosure form?
01
Patients seeking medical treatment: Anyone who is seeking medical treatment from a healthcare professional or facility may be required to fill out a patient disclosure form.
02
New patients: When visiting a new healthcare provider for the first time, it is common to fill out a patient disclosure form to provide the necessary information for proper diagnosis and treatment.
03
Patients undergoing procedures: Before undergoing any medical procedures, patients may need to complete a patient disclosure form to ensure that healthcare providers have accurate and up-to-date information about their health.
04
Patients participating in research studies: Individuals participating in research studies or clinical trials may be asked to complete a patient disclosure form to gather data and ensure their eligibility for the study.
05
Medical insurance claimants: Individuals filing medical insurance claims may be required to fill out a patient disclosure form as part of the claims process.
